    Default DAMMIT! DQ from Military for astigmatism..

    So after about a 2 week process of dealing with a recruiter, gathering all the necessary paperworks, and what not.. I get to the physical station (MEPS) and get Disqualified after my physical for having an astigmatism in one eye.

    My prescription is 5.50 - 3.00 x 180 in one eye, which is perfectly acceptable.. but my other eye is 4.00 -3.75 x 180.. which is .75 diopters over the acceptable standard. Anyway, I'm scheduled for some sort of Orthupedic (sp?) consul, and they said all I can do is hope that they grant me a waiver stating it won't impair my ability to serve. This has never been an issue with me before, it is correctable to 20/20 (I wear contacts). But everywhere I read tells me that any astigmatism over 3 diopters is an automatic disqualification because of conflictions with standard issue equipment (refractions in goggles and masks lenses etc).

    MEPS will notify your recruiter of the appointment for the consult. At this time you may have a hard time getting approved if your vision is as bad as you say it is. Waivers right now are getting harder to come by now that the Army has met its end strength goal of 547,000 a year or so earlier than expected.
